    This throwing clay is made in-house in small batches at Greenwich House Pottery. The recipe is credited to Jeff Oestreich. Recommended for firing up to cone 10.

    THROWING CLAY BODY

    Water content: 34.33%
    Firing Range: Δ06-12, Oxidation or Reduction
    Shrinkage: Green=6%, Δ06=7%, Δ04=8%, Δ2=12%, Δ10=15%
    Porosity: Δ06=13.5%, Δ04=12.7%, Δ2=4.3%, Δ10=.4%
    Color/texture: Tan-Brown, speckled in reduction smooth clay
